Does sky want to keep existing customers?

I spent one hour 30 mins chatting with two robots and two humans today to renew my Sky Q TV and broadband package.  Finally got the deal price I wanted and said yes to go ahead then the virtual chat cut off and said it had closed.  So annoying I feel like I have just wasted my time and got no where and really cant be bothered to go through it again , Im tempted just to cancel.  Sky is so hard to get through to anyone espcially when just trying to renew at a decent price!!

Re: Does sky want to keep existing customers?

Posted by a Superuser, not a Sky employee. Find out more

To cancel, you'll need to Sky a call to give the notice required - 31 days for TV, 14 for broadband. When the bots asks why you're calling, say 'cancel'. Ironically the cancellations team are the best people to ask about a deal.
